Less flushing? It’s the law!

Written April 15th, 2013 by

Our Oregon legislature is filled with earnest legislators who like nothing better than to make new laws. So it won’t be a complete surprise for you to learn that they intend to tighten their control of, among many other things, the amount of water you flush down the toilet. On April 12, according to the […]

